I have done several. Clean out all the old caulk, wire brush or grind any rust out in the seams, and apply a rust sealing paint to the seams. Then reapply the seam sealer (3m fast n firm and Crest qwik-seam are both good). I prefer the type that uses a caulk gun for these areas. You can use paint thinner on a small brush to smooth any areas needed (or wax and grease remover). Hope this helps.
